			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Facebook is strenghtening it&#8217;s position in Social with the Instagram aquisition. The deal came at an amazing valuation of $1B.</p>
<p>There are several noticeable things with the acqusition:</p>
<ul>
<li>Just before the acquisition Instagram actually closed a $50M investment round, those investors instantly doubled their money</li>
<li>The instagram user base on iOS alone is 27 million and when they launched their Android app it received 1million downloads in the first 24 hours</li>
<li>This indicates that Facebook could potentially become a common exit option if you manage to build something that scales fast enough</li>
</ul>
<p>The next step after image sharing is naturally video sharing. We have long believed that video sharing from the Smartphone will be a key feature and have therefore devloped the Mobile Send application to capture and upload videos from your Smartphone with direct publishing to your blog etc.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>While we see the raise of video in the context of e-commerce and preparing for our coming engagements such as <a href="http://litium.se/">Litium</a>, <a href="https://klarna.com/index.php?option=com_content&#038;view=article&#038;id=80&#038;Itemid=194&#038;landing=b2b">Klarna</a> and <a href="http://nordicecommerceknowledge.se/">Nordic E-commerce Knowledge</a>, we have started to collect our thoughts and findings about video as sales tool.</p>
<p>Many individual companies do A/B testing specific types of videos on their own home pages, but these numbers are not usually disclosed, and we have yet to see industry-wide studies looking at the effects of these specific videos.  However, the effectiveness of product videos in the ecommerce and retail space is well-documented, and the same factors that help these videos sell products seem to apply to promoting websites and apps as well. That is typically our experience of the companies that keep track and disclosed the data to us, videos usually <a href="http://transvideo.com/blog/2010/06/why-overview-videos-matter">improved conversion rates by 15%-75%.</a></p>

<p>If you are going to make a video, here a few basic rules to keep in mind:</p>
<p>1. Don’t make a “viral” video.  While there are <a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ZUG9qYTJMsI">extremely successful and truly viral videos out there</a> people don’t usually realize the time, effort, and experience required to <a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=GsoNcm25wRM">create something people actually want to share</a>.  And even if they do, virality itself is unpredictable.  Most companies would be better off leveraging the existing organic traffic on their site and focus on turning those users into customers, rather than spending resources they may not have trying to designing to get a mass audience to post their videos on their Facebook page. This doesn’t mean the video needs to be a PowerPoint pitch deck, or that it can’t be engaging, but that the top priority should be to explain how a product fits into a user’s life, and not shareability.</p>
<p>2. Don’t just make a product walkthrough.  Product walkthroughs have their place, but they are only effective after the user understands what the product is about in the first place. Don’t just do a product demo, starting at the login screen, and walking through all the features.  Answer the question, “How does this product fit into my life?”, or “Why should I use this?”, before answering “How does this work?”.  You want to pique the user’s interest with the video, then let them figure how the product works on their own, by signing up and using it. Having said that…</p>
<p>3. Prioritize your message and keep it short.  It is tempting to want to present every use case, every benefit, to as many different audiences as possible, as you might in a pitch deck.  However, the sweet spot for these videos tend to be around 45-90 seconds.  Shorter than 45 seconds feels sales-y and incomplete, and viewers don’t hang around videos that are longer than 90 seconds, so putting too much in there hurts you. That means that you should pick just a few messages to put in the video  Are you targeting your dream user, or are you catering to early adopters (i.e.: “<a href="http://techcrunch.com/2012/03/11/how-to-design-for-normals/">Normals</a>” vs “TechCrunch Readers”)?  Are you trying to differentiate yourselves from an established competitor?  Are you solving a problem that hasn’t been tackled, or is it a new solution to an old problem?  Is there information that all users must know about your product ahead of time to use it effectively?  These are the types of questions that help determine what goes into a final video.  Focus on the three most important things, and then let them move on from the video to your product.</p>
<p>4. Include a call to action at the end.  Videos perform better if the user knows what to do after the video is done. And if you tell a user to download a product, make sure there is a prominent “Download” button next to the video at all times. (See: <a href="http://flipboard.com/">Flipboard</a>).</p>
<p>5. Prominently feature the video.  The video does little good if it is hidden behind a lot of links.  Put it on your home page, and place a large “play” button on a still of the video for maximum effectiveness. (See: <a href="https://nextdoor.com/">Nextdoor</a>).</p>
<p>6. Quality matters.  While you may now be tempted to grab your camcorder and record a video of your product, the production quality does matter.  A concise script, good design, clear visuals, and good quality audio all make a difference in whether users watch the video, and how they react to it and to your product.  This is especially true if your product has privacy implications, or is business to business – an amateurish production may give the impression that the company is not reputable and is run from a college dorm room.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We are proud to announce an updated version of our Cloud Video <a href="http://lemonwhale.com/api-2" title="API">API</a>. The new API features functions such as simplified video upload and extended search/sorting functions. We are also including new playlist functions in the API.</p>
<p>Our developers at Lemonwhale have been power users of other websites APIs for a long time and in that process we have understood what works and what does not. One of the things that we just hate is when the API dictates us to use a certain language or format. This was one of the first things we solve in our API by allowing developers to decide between XML, JSON and JSONP when exchanging information with our API.</p>
<p>One of the best proof points for our API is that we regularly use it for customer projects ourselves. Thus we notice what is missing or difficult. One of the latest features that we added was support for playlists so that besides the category lists available already you can also work with playlists in the API.
